My dear mother has passed away only days ago. I lived with her, as her carer. I know that I can get carers allowance for 8 weeks but is there also a reduction in Council Tax now that I become responsible for it?
Thank you in advance for any advice.

sad news @Daffy123 my condolences
it's so hard losing your mum ... and having to deal with the everyday stuff

living on your own in a property means you are eligible for the single occupant's discount of 25% ... have a look on your LA's website and it will have a section about this
